Do Away With Envy

Envy is wanting the possessions and destiny of others.

To be filled with envy is to be filled with a jealousy of what others may have that you do not have. However, in the real sense, to be envious of others is really to be unhappy with what the Creator has given to you and to be unhappy with the destiny that Yahweh has laid down for you.

Envy removes you from the path that Yahweh have created for you. Being removed from your personal path, removes the direction in your life, and confusion sets in. The bitterness caused by envy will defile you and destroy you.

Overcome envy, knowing that the Creator has the perfect plan for your life, and has all good things planned for you.

The Capable Wife

Who does find a capable wife? For she is worth far more than rubies. The heart of her husband shall trust her, And he has no lack of gain. She shall do him good, and not evil, All the days of her life.
Mishlĕ (Proverbs) 31:10‭-‬12 TS2009

Who is a capable wife? The introductory portion of this piece in the Book of Proverbs opens our eyes to the major characteristics of a good wife.

When it says her worth is more than rubies, what is being portrayed is that she cannot be purchased as rubies cannot be purchased with money. A capable wife remains for her husband 100% and nothing can take her away from him. Not even the cares of life.

This is the reason why her husband trusts in her. Her loyalty is not in doubt. Her husband can then entrust her with all that he has and makes her the General Manager of his estate. He is sure that all his interests will be perfectly taken care of.

In her position as General Manager, she is completely devoted to her husband and the man gets 100% of all returns from his estate. No withholding tax is charged by the wife. She concerns herself with ensuring that the husband gets only good and not bad.

That is a capable wife. No personal interest but her husband’s interest is paramount. All her knowledge and resources are geared toward making her husband known and respected in society.

Let’s Help The Needy

The mismatch between the rich and the poor is very glaring. Looking at the society, I am of the opinion that a system of redistribution of wealth will be ideal. I am not advocating communism, but there is a lot to be done by religious organisations and the likes to impart the teaching of sharing among their members.

The Scripture (Bible) shows that Yahweh is concerned about the rich making provisions for the poor. It is not just giving alms, but the provision cut across proceeds from their farms, non-interest lending, giving part of their tithes to the needy, taking care of the widows & fatherless.

Remember, that “pure religion and undefiled before our Elohim and Abba is this: to visit the fatherless and widows in their affliction, and to keep oneself unstained by the world” (James 1:27).

How much this will help the needy if it is adopted, is glaring to us all.

FORGIVE OTHERS

When two elements work together to perform a task, their constant rubbing of each other causes wear and tear. Same thing happens to us as humans when we do things together. Unlike elements, our feelings make us to sense pain and hurt leading to dissatisfaction with the other party. This negative emotion causes us to pull apart from each other affecting the way we love ourselves.

To restore our bond of oneness, there is need to forgive each other over and over again. Forgiveness is a very important tool in maintaining love in every relationship. We learn this from the Creator who is forgiving and readily restores us whenever we ask for His forgiveness.

But, why must I keep on forgiving people for all the bad things they do to me? You must forgive because Yahweh also forgives you all the time. Yeshua stated that we must forgive “seventy times seven times” (Matthew 18:22).

When you hold on to what anyone have to you and refuse to forgive them, you cause a break in the oneness of humanity. It means you are working against the will of the Most High.
